Do ct scans cause cancer? i got a ct scan done on my head and abdominal with contrast at only 20/female. i'm very worried about it now and if it will impact my future cancer risk. how do we know how risky/dangerous these scans are?

Don't worry: Although radiation exposure from x-rays or CT scan can (very minimally) increase your cancer risk... the risk from one CT scan of head and one of abdomen would be extremely small! If you had many tests, there is an additive effect which at some point might raise a little concern. As we get older, cancer itself does become more common (maybe 1/3 of us over our lifetime), but not from one CT scan.
